27 Amendments (Best Definitions)
Exam Questions and Answers
1st Amendment - -Freedom of Religion, Speech, Press, Assembly, and
Petition
- 2nd Amendment - -Right to Keep, Bear Arms
- 3rd Amendment - -No Lodging Troops in Private Homes
- 4th Amendment - -No unlawful Search, Seizures
- 5th Amendment - -Criminal Proceedings;guarantees Due Process; Eminent
Domain; no Double Jeopardy; no Self incrimination
- 6th Amendment - -Criminal Proceedings; right to speedy and fair trial;
Must inform defendant of charge/s; Right to Attorney; Right to fair impartial
jury
- 7th Amendment - -Trial by Jury in Civil Cases where value exceeds $20
- 8th Amendment - -No excessive Bail or fines; No Cruel or Unusual
Punishment
- 9th Amendment - -Unenumerated Rights (not all individual rights are listed
in constitution)
- 10th Amendment - -Powers Reserved to the States (limits the power of
Federal Government)
- 11th Amendment - -Suits Against States
- 12th Amendment - -Requires separate Electoral ballots for President and
VIce President
- 13th Amendment - -Abolished slavery
- 14th Amendment - -Grants citizenship to "all persons born or naturalized
in the United States"; it forbids any state to deny any person "life, liberty or
property, without due process of law" or to "deny to any person within its
jurisdiction the equal protection of its laws."
- 15th Amendment - -No denying Right to Vote--- Race, Color, Servitude
